Avoiding high energy bills with a dehumidifier may seem counterintuitive at first. Many homeowners assume that adding another electrical appliance will increase costs. However, when used correctly, a dehumidifier can actually help reduce heating expenses and improve overall energy efficiency.

Damp air takes longer to heat than dry air. In homes with high humidity, heating systems work harder, leading to increased energy consumption and higher bills. By reducing moisture levels, a dehumidifier allows homes to warm up faster and retain heat more effectively.

The Link Between Damp, Cold Homes, and Energy Costs

High humidity makes indoor spaces feel colder, even when the temperature is adequate. As a result, occupants often turn up the heating unnecessarily.

Common causes include:

  • Condensation on walls and windows
  • Poor insulation
  • Limited ventilation
  • Drying clothes indoors

These factors increase both moisture levels and heating demand.

How a Dehumidifier Helps Reduce Energy Bills

Faster Heating

Dry air heats more quickly than damp air, reducing the time heating systems need to run.

Improved Heat Retention

Lower humidity helps prevent heat loss through damp walls and surfaces.

Reduced Reliance on Heating

Homes feel warmer at lower thermostat settings.

Prevention of Damp Damage

Avoiding damp reduces the need for costly repairs and remedial work.

Energy Consumption of Modern Dehumidifiers

Modern dehumidifiers are designed with efficiency in mind. Many models consume less electricity than a standard tumble dryer cycle and include automatic shut-off features once the target humidity is reached.

Dehumidifiers vs Other Damp Solutions

Opening windows during winter leads to heat loss. Constant heating without moisture control is inefficient. A dehumidifier provides a controlled, targeted solution that balances comfort and cost.

Best Practices to Avoid High Energy Bills with a Dehumidifier:

  • Use humidity sensors to avoid overuse
  • Place the unit in high-moisture areas
  • Combine with sensible heating schedules
  • Close internal doors to improve efficiency

When used strategically, a dehumidifier becomes part of an energy-saving system rather than an added expense.

Does a dehumidifier use a lot of electricity?
No, modern units are designed to be energy efficient when used correctly.

Can a dehumidifier replace heating?
No, but it supports heating by improving warmth retention.

Is it cheaper to use a dehumidifier than open windows in winter?
Yes, as it avoids heat loss while controlling moisture.
